About Economics, Masters by Research - at Erasmus School of Economics

The programme is a small scale, intensive programme for students who want to pursue a PhD in Economics, Econometrics or Finance at one of the schools in business and economics of Erasmus University Rotterdam, University of Amsterdam and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am.

This is what the programme offers:

A Small-scale programme

Admissions are highly selective and competitive. Each cohort is made of  maximum of 25-30 students. Tinbergen Institute runs its own scholarship programme for its students.

Selected teaching staff

The teaching staff is selected from among the best researchers of the three faculties participating in the programme, and by internationally renowned experts who are invited to give guest lectures in their fields of research.

Stepping stone for PhD research

Most students who successfully complete the programme obtain a fully paid PhD position at one of the schools that jointly run Tinbergen Institute.

Amsterdam and  Rotterdam

Tinbergen Institute has its own offices and a dedicated support staff in both Amsterdam and Rotterdam. In Rotterdam, as Tinbergen Institute  is located on ESE’s campus, students make use of ESE’s campus facilities. In Amsterdam, students have their own computer facilities and office space in a dedicated location just a few hundreds meters away from the campus of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am; Tinbergen Institute Amsterdam
